> -----Original Message----- > From: Andre Przywara <andre.przywara@arm.com> > Sent: Friday, January 10, 2020 5:24 PM > To: David S . Miller <davem@davemloft.net>; Radhey Shyam Pandey > <radheys@xilinx.com> > Cc: Michal Simek <michals@xilinx.com>; Robert Hancock > <hancock@sedsystems.ca>; netdev@vger.kernel.org; linux-arm- > kernel@lists.infradead.org; lin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org > Subject: [PATCH 02/14] net: axienet: Propagate failure of DMA descriptor > setup > > When we fail allocating the DMA buffers in axienet_dma_bd_init(), we > report this error, but carry on with initialisation nevertheless. > > This leads to a kernel panic when the driver later wants to send a > packet, as it uses uninitialised data structures. > > Make the axienet_device_reset() routine return an error value, as it > contains the DMA buffer initialisation. Make sure we propagate the error > up the chain and eventually fail the driver initialisation, to avoid > relying on non-initialised buffers. > > Signed-off-by: Andre Przywara <andre.przywara@arm.com> Reviewed-by: Radhey Shyam Pandey <radhey.shyam.pandey@xilinx.com>
